INTRODUCTION T-6Al-2Zr-1Mo-1V ttanum alloy (TA15) s wdely used n aerospace ndustry, and heat transfer phenomenon s major focused for ts weldng technology researches. The reason may be that heat transfer s specal n weldng because of the nteracton between materal and heat source, resultng n that temperature feld s dffcult to predct precsely. The relatonshp of ntegrated weldng modelng methodology proposed by Krkaldy (Krkaldy, 1991) s shown n Fg.1. For the lmt knowledge of us, ths model s dealsm. However some parts of the model can be developed and combned by the effort of many academc researches. In temperature feld modelng, famous Fourer heat transfer law s wdely appled (Deng & Murakawa, 2006, 2008). The nterestng work manly s how to consder the weldng heat source, snce the character of weldng s such dfferent. The poneerng work from D Rosonthal (Rosenthal, 1941) who put forward the analytc movement pont heat source model. Then V. Pavelc (Pavelc, 1969) proposed famous gauss heat source model wth Gaussan flux dstrbuton. It was a surface heat source and was dffculty employed n molten pool. The famous body heat source, double ellpsod heat source model, s proposed by Goldak (JOHN GOLDAK, 1984). The model s wdely appled n arc weldng now. For laser weldng, whch has a nal heads morphology, t was not as applcable. In order to smulate the character of laser weldng, Lankalapall (Lankalapall, 1996) developed a cone heat source model and Wu S (Wu, 2004) proposed a Rotatng gauss body heat source model. These models were further mproved for the complex physcal phenomena n laser weldng and then the combned heat source models were often used. Xu G.X and Wu C.S et al. (Xu, 2008a, 2008b, 2009) proposed four combned heat source models ncludng gauss and cone combned heat source model. Meanwhle, the transformaton knetcs n the weldng thermal cycles were contnuously studed. Phase volume fracton s functon of coordnate and tme. The poneerng research may be the Johnson-Mehl- Avram-Kolmogorov (JMAK) equaton (Avram, 1939, 1940, 1941) whch was obtaned n sothermal

2 2 condton. Based on JMAK equaton, TC4 ttanum phase transformaton knetcs of the weldng process was studed by Elmer and Palmer et al (Elmer, 2004). The phase transformaton dffuson actvaton energy was determned by growth - control mechansm and the Avrn ndex was determned by the dffuson - control mechansm. Malnov et al. (Malnov, 2003; S. Malnov, Novoselova, & Sha, 2004; S. Malnov, 2001) conducted systematcally researches for phase transformaton smulatons of many ttanum such as T-6Al-4V, T-8Al-1Mo-1V and T-10V-2Fe-3Al durng sothermal phase change process. The β to α phase transformaton model was developed and verfed by resstvty and dfferental scannng calormeter (DSC) experments. TC4 ttanum phase transformaton model n TIG weldng was proposed by GaoyangM (M, We, Zhan, Gu, & Yu, 2014), whch ft the nonsothermal process well. In ths paper the coupled thermal-phase transformaton FE model s further mproved to quanttatvely nvestgate the nfluence of phase transformaton on temperature felds durng laser weldng of TA15.
